Trabalhando em Linux com a festança Shell
o bater shell serve como mediador entre o usuário e o kernel Linux, com bcinza sendo o shell mais comum em uso hoje. Para interagir com o bcinza shell, você precisa entender como as obras de tubulação (permitindo a saída de um comando para ser a entrada do próximo), como usar o redirecionamento, e alguns comandos e variáveis de ambiente básicas:
Tubo:
command1 | command2
redirecionamentos:
comando > Arquivo: Saída vai para Arquivo
comando lt; Arquivo: A entrada de Arquivo
comando >> Arquivo: Anexar Arquivo
command2> arquivo: Erros de ir para Arquivo
comandos:
aliás: Define um atalho para um comando longo
a propósito: Pesquisa as manpages para palavras-chave
história: Exibe os comandos mais recentes
localizar: Localiza arquivos
onde é: Localiza arquivos executáveis para um comando
qual: Mostra o caminho completo para um comando
homem: Exibe ajuda on-line
printenv: Exibe as variáveis de ambiente
Variáveis ambientais:
CASA: Diretório home do usuário
CAMINHO: Diretórios de pesquisa para comandos
PRAZO: Nome de um tipo de terminal